In the UK, the Reform UK party, prominently led by Nigel Farage, has emerged with an unconventional proposal. Inspired by the policies of former U.S. President Donald Trump, the party suggests collaborating with international partners such as El Salvador for incarceration solutions. This approach mirrors ideas championed by Trump’s associate, Rudy Giuliani, spotlighting a potential shift towards international partnerships in addressing domestic issues. As the party continues to gather momentum, the discussion around innovative correctional strategies undeniably piques public interest and debate.

Meanwhile, in Italy, cultural sensitivities have led to a significant alteration in musical events. Renowned conductor Valery Gergiev, noted for his pro-Putin stance, was recently removed from a prestigious festival lineup near Naples. The decision reflects the increasing scrutiny on public figures associated with divisive political narratives. This cancellation underscores the delicate balance between artistic expression and political alignment, inviting broader discussions on the extent to which personal beliefs should influence professional opportunities in the arts.

In the serene landscapes of Australia, an unusual tale of a crocodile sighting in Noosa has captivated the nation’s imagination. Originating from a seemingly innocuous Facebook post, the sighting of a 3.5-meter crocodile has stirred widespread curiosity, spreading rapidly across various media platforms. This incident serves as a reminder of the intriguing interplay between social media and traditional news outlets, and how modern communication shapes public discourse, blending folklore with reality.

On a constructive note, the Portuguese government is taking significant steps towards heritage conservation. A notable investment of 8.8 million euros has been earmarked for restoration projects in collaboration with seven municipalities. This initiative marks a dedicated effort toward preserving cultural patrimony, aligning economic resources with community values. Such initiatives highlight the commitment to safeguarding historical assets for future generations, merging economic investment with cultural stewardship.
